Latino Documentary Photographer José Galvez has just put out a book of stories from his childhood called Shine Boy. They are stories of his experiences as a shoeshine boy and the mentors he met along the way.

For over 40 years, Tucson native José Galvez has documented Latino culture in the US. While working at the Arizona Daily Star José seemed to always focus his lens on the barrios of Tucson.
In 1984, he was on a team of reporters and photographers that won a Pulitzer Prize for meritorious public service for the Los Angeles Times series "Southern California's Latino Community." Since he left the Los Angeles Times in 1992 he has continued to document Latino life in the US , was one of several photo editors for the book Americanos: Latino Life in the United States and published his first solo book, Vatos in 2000.
In 2004, José and his family moved to North Carolina where he continues to photograph Latino migration to the southern US.
